TPZ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review
38 of the 4,017 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Tortoise Electrification Infrastructure ETF (TPZ)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$40.8M — down 6.1% from $43.4M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 5 funds opened new TPZ positions and 1 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 11 added to existing stakes and 12 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Wells Fargo, adding an estimated $685K. The largest seller was Advisors Asset Management, cutting an estimated $3.52M.
